当我开始在 Facebook 上使用某个应用程序时,该应用程序显示“10K 人使用此应用程序”,但在此之前我需要“订阅”该应用程序(单击一个按钮,告诉我我将使用该应用程序) 我如何使用自己的应用程序做到这一点,以便跟踪使用它的用户数量?
此外,当有人开始使用我的应用程序(在线杂志)时,我想用“John Doe 正在阅读<应用程序名称>”之类的内容更新他们的活动
我需要 Facebook API 的哪些元素来实现这些行为?
当我开始在 Facebook 上使用某个应用程序时,该应用程序显示“10K 人使用此应用程序”,但在此之前我需要“订阅”该应用程序(单击一个按钮,告诉我我将使用该应用程序) 我如何使用自己的应用程序做到这一点,以便跟踪使用它的用户数量?
此外,当有人开始使用我的应用程序(在线杂志)时,我想用“John Doe 正在阅读<应用程序名称>”之类的内容更新他们的活动
我需要 Facebook API 的哪些元素来实现这些行为?
Facebook 会自动将“使用此应用的人数”统计数据添加到应用身份验证对话框中。如果您想在您的应用程序中(手动)显示它,您可以调用/{your_app_id}
并使用weekly_active_users
或monthly_active_users
计数。
至于活动,Facebook 会自动发布“用户正在使用应用程序”。您将无法执行“用户正在阅读应用程序”,因为页面需要是接受“阅读”的对象类型。“阅读”仅在您阅读博客、文章等时才有效。
如果您仍然有兴趣追求它,您需要获得publish_actions
许可并且您需要read
在应用程序设置中注册该操作。facebook 文档包含您入门所需的一切。